Biography

Allison Tant is a Democratic State Representative for Florida House District 9, which includes parts of Leon County, all of Jefferson County, and most of Madison County. First elected in 2020 and reelected subsequently, her terms extend through 2028. Born in Jacksonville, Florida, she resides in Tallahassee with her husband, attorney Barry Richard, three children, and two stepchildren. She is the founder of Independence Landing , an affordable housing option for ad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ities, and serves on various boards including the Challenger Learning Center and the Anti-Defamation League of Florida regional representative. In 2013, she was inducted into the Tallahassee Democrat’s "25 Women You Need to Know."

Education and Political Experience

Education: Florida State University, BA in Communications and BS in Psychology .

Political Experience: Ranking member of the House Post-Secondary Education & Workforce Committee and Commerce Committee; member of Ways & Means, Rules, Health Care Regulation, Insurance & Banking Committees, and previously the Select Committee on Hurricane Recovery and Resiliency. Prior roles include Founding Chair Emeritus for KEYS , a scholarship program for students with disabilities, where she helped establish programs like TCC Eagle Connections, SOAR job certification, and ACE Summer Institute. She previously served on the Children's Home Society Central Division Board , including as Board Chair and Advocacy Committee Chair . Active in community organizations such as Tallahassee Rotary Club, Capital Women’s Network, and Tiger Bay.
